When you don't have enough of the digestive enzyme lactase to digest the lactose in dairy, you can experience abdominal discomfort and digestive issues after eating products like milk,. If you feel bloated and gassy after you drink milk or eat ice cream, you might be lactose intolerant. Why does ice cream make me feel sick but no other dairy product does? In people with lactose intolerance, their small intestine doesn’t produce enough lactase to digest all of the lactose in the dairy products such as milk, ice cream, pudding, and soft cheeses.
